Medicare drug protection aids purchase prescription medicines you may need. Even if you don’t choose prescription medications now, you need to consider finding Medicare drug coverage. Medicare drug protection is optional and is offered to All people with Medicare. If you choose not for getting it if you’re first qualified, and you don’t produce other creditable prescription drug protection (like drug coverage from an employer or union) or get More Assist, you’ll possible pay out a late enrollment penalty for those who be a part of a system later. Normally, you’ll pay this penalty for so long as you have Medicare drug protection. To get Medicare drug coverage, you will need to join a Medicare-accredited approach that offers drug coverage. Just about every plan may vary in Charge and specific medicines protected.

There are actually 2 approaches to get Medicare drug protection:
one. Medicare drug designs. These plans include drug coverage to First Medicare, some Medicare Charge Designs, some Non-public Fee‑for‑Services programs, and Health care Discounts Account designs. You must have Medicare Part A (Hospital Insurance plan) and/or Medicare Aspect B (Professional medical Coverage) to hitch a different Medicare drug system.

two. Medicare Edge Prepare (Portion C) or other Medicare Overall health Program with drug coverage. You receive all your Part A, Part B, and drug protection, by these strategies. Don't forget, you will need to have Component A and Part B to hitch a Medicare Edge Program, and not all of these designs present drug coverage.

Becoming a member of a Medicare drug system may impact your Medicare Benefit System
For those who join a Medicare Advantage Program, you’ll normally get drug protection by that approach. In certain kinds of programs that could’t offer you drug protection (like Clinical Discounts Account designs) or pick out not to provide drug protection (like selected Non-public Cost-for-Assistance options), you could sign up for a individual Medicare drug prepare. In case you’re in the Overall health Upkeep Business, HMO Stage-of-Services plan, or Most popular Service provider Group, so you be a part of a separate drug approach, you’ll be disenrolled from the Medicare
Benefit Strategy and returned to Original Medicare.

You may only be part of a separate Medicare drug approach devoid click here of dropping your current health and fitness coverage whenever you’re inside of a:

Personal Fee-for-Assistance Program
Medical Discounts Account Program
Cost Prepare
Particular employer-sponsored Medicare wellbeing programs
